For this role, Henie's American film debut, she had to be taught her dialogue lines phonetically since she didn't speak fluent English. After the film turned out to be a big box office hit, Henie was convinced her thick accent was part of her audience appeal, and refused Fox's offer to hire her an English coach for future roles. As a result, Henie's Norwegian accent remained throughout her film career.
